YALE GAME APPLICATIONS DUE

WILL DEFINITELY CLOSE NEXT THURSDAY.--NO PUBLIC SALE OF TICKETS.

All applications for tickets for the Harvard-Yale football game will positively close on Thursday evening at 6 o'clock, according to the final statement made by F. W. Moore '93, graduate treasurer of the H. A. A., yesterday. It was further explained that any rumors to the effect that tickets would go on sale publicly after that time were entirely unfounded, since there are only 48,000 seats for some 70,000 possible applicants from both universities.

Record Application Expected.

Appearances so far indicate that this year there probably will be a record number of applications as already a total of 3,426 has been received from the University out of a possible 5,000 and many more are expected during the rush of the last few days. These figures are inclusive of the members of the graduate schools as well as the undergraduates but do not include applications from members of the Faculty as the latter are classed under the head of graduate applicants.
